The business that creates and sells polymers with electroluminescent qualities is known as the electroluminescent polymers market. When an electric current flows through a substance, the process is known as electroluminescence, which causes the material to emit light. An organic semiconductor material called an electroluminescent polymer sometimes referred to as a luminescent polymer or a light-emitting polymer, can emit light in response to an applied voltage or electric current. Conjugated systems, which are configurations of alternate single and double bonds along the polymer chain, constitute the basis for these polymers most frequently. Due to the potential uses of these materials in a variety of industries, such as lighting, displays, signage, and optoelectronic devices, the electroluminescent polymers market has drawn a lot of interest.

Due to the benefits provided by this technology, such as flexibility, low power consumption, and compatibility with large-area manufacturing processes, the market for electroluminescent polymers was anticipated to expand. The need for electroluminescent polymers was also driven by the growing use of OLED displays in smartphones, televisions, and other electronic devices.

Global Electroluminescent Polymers Market Challenges:

Increasing the efficiency and longevity of electroluminescent polymers is one of their main problems. To ensure long-lasting performance, it is essential to increase the materials' stability and electroluminescent quantum yield. To meet these problems, research and development efforts are concentrated on creating new polymer compositions and device topologies.

Compared to other lighting technologies, electroluminescent polymer production costs might be quite high. It is extremely difficult to scale up production while maintaining consistent quality and using cost-effective manufacturing procedures. Environmental elements like moisture, oxygen, and heat can be harsh on electroluminescent polymers. For their practical applications, maintaining stability under various environmental conditions is essential. To improve the environmental stability of electroluminescent polymer devices, researchers are investigating protective encapsulating strategies and barrier materials.

Global Electroluminescent Polymers Market Recent Developments:

  • In June 2022, for usage in electroluminescent displays, Merck introduced new emerald green OLED (organic light-emitting diode) materials. These materials, which are intended for usage in applications like smartphones, televisions, and other displays, are believed to be more efficient and brighter than earlier iterations.
  • In January 2022, with the introduction of a new product line dubbed LuminiNova, Solvay announced the expansion of its portfolio of electroluminescent polymers. The new line is made for use in a variety of applications, such as automotive lighting, signage, and consumer electronics, and is stated to offer great efficiency, versatility, and durability.
  • In August 2021, the creation of a new OLED material by Sumitomo Chemical, which offers increased efficiency and durability, was disclosed. The new material, according to the business, is more affordable than alternative possibilities, opening it up to a larger range of sectors and uses.

Electroluminescent polymers based on polyfluorene are extensively employed because of their superior performance traits, including great brightness, color purity, and good film-forming abilities. They are employed in many different contexts, such as lighting, exhibits, and signage. High quantum efficiency and strong color stability make PPV-based electroluminescent polymers ideal for use in high-performance displays and lighting systems. Additionally, they are utilized in organic photovoltaic (OPV) systems. Due to their excellent thermal stability and high conductivity, PPP-based electroluminescent polymers are suitable for use in high-temperature applications. They are frequently utilized in sensors, OPVs, and OLEDs. Electroluminescent polymers based on PPPV are very luminous and have great electroluminescence efficiency. They are employed in many different applications, such as sensors, displays, and lighting.
